Chelsea ace David Luiz and Arsenal's Laurent Koscienly targeted by Barcelona

It is understood the Spanish giants are looking for a quick fix to replace the injured Samuel Umtiti and Thomas Vermaelen.


And according to Mundo Deportivo, the Premier League pair have both been sounded out as potential options, despite Arsenal defender Koscielny not playing since May 3 due to an achilles tendon rupture.

Barca would look to sign an 'experienced and cheap' centre-back in January to provide support to Gerard Pique and Clement Lenglet – but David Luiz is an ever-present in the Premier League this season and has starred under Maurizio Sarri at Chelsea.

It is believed the club would ideally offer a six-month contract at the Nou Camp with the option of an additional year come the end of the season.

Ajax starlet Mattjis de Ligt is thought to be Barcelona's top priority but is unlikely to be available until the summer transfer window opens.

In the meantime, former Chelsea defender Branislav Ivanovic is a shock target on a list of potential defenders.

At 34, the Zenit defender would certainly fit the 'experienced and cheap' criteria.

Pantomime villain Pepe is another player on the list compiled by Mundo Deportivo.

But he would surely be an unpopular option among Barcelona fans after the Portugal defender, 35, spent ten years at Real Madrid.


Medhi Bentatia, Raul Albiol, Benedikt Howedes, Vedran Corluka, Domagoj Vida, Dante, Neven Subotic, Timothee Kolodziejczak, Adil Rami and Jose Fonte complete the underwhelming list of mediocre centre-backs all past their best.
But Barcelona hope they can land one of them to simply 'do a job' for the second half of the season as they seek the LaLiga, Champions League and Copa del Rey treble.
